HTTP vs TCP IP, send data to a web server - Stack Overflow In Short: TCP is a transport-layer protocol, and HTTP is an application-layer protocol that runs over TCP Detail:To understand the difference (and a lot of other networking topics), you need to understand the idea of a layered networking model
HTTP vs HTTPS vs TCP vs TLS vs UDP - in28minutes Cloud Network Layer vs Transport Layer vs Application Layer Let’s now compare the three important layers: Network Layer: IP (Internet Protocol): Transfer bytes Unreliable Transport Layer: TCP (Transmission Control): Reliability > Performance; TLS (Transport Layer Security): Secure TCP; UDP (User Datagram Protocol): Performance
